Artwork preview

Going to Bed (Le coucher)

Albert Besnard

National Gallery of Art

The image depicts two individuals. One person is lying down on a bed, facing left, with their head resting on a pillow. The second person is upright, reclined on the same surface, with one arm supporting their upper body. Both individuals have softly delineated facial features, typical of etching. The second person's hair appears curly or tousled. The clothing is not detailed. The background shows dynamic strokes, possibly representing drapery, adding depth to the composition against the lighter shading of the bed or surface.
